I was made aware of the fact that Hasselblad used to add, on request, electronic "databus" contacts to CFi and maybe CF lenses.

Is this still possible?

If not by Hasselblad, maybe someone else is doing the work.

If not, has anyone tried to purchase a "donor" lens with contacts and use it to supply the raw parts for another lens you want to add contacts to?

I could really use help figuring this out. I would love to add the electronic "databus" contacts to a Hasselblad 100mm CFi lens, among other lenses.
